What are common electrical issues in older Massachusetts homes?

Older homes in Massachusetts may have outdated wiring, such as knob-and-tube or insufficient amperage, that cannot safely support modern electrical needs. These systems often lack grounding. Upgrading is crucial for safety and functionality.

How does Massachusetts's weather affect electrical systems?

Massachusetts experiences cold winters requiring significant heating power and warm, humid summers demanding robust cooling. This dual demand places a substantial load on electrical systems. Ensuring circuits have adequate capacity is vital.

Do electricians in Massachusetts handle HVAC electrical work?

Yes, electricians in Massachusetts are well-equipped to handle the electrical aspects of HVAC systems. This includes ensuring correct wiring, breaker protection, and thermostat integration for both heating and cooling. They help maintain system efficiency and safety.
